[16a-E502-1] Semiconductor heat flux control technology pioneered by photonics perspective

Masahiro Nomura1 (1.IIS, UTokyo)

Keywords:Phonon engineering, Nanostructure

Based on our research experience in the field of photonics and heat transfer engineering, we will show how photonics can be used to understand heat transport phenomena in semiconductors and to develop thermal control technologies. Phonon engineering has much to learn from photonics in its pioneering due to the similarity of transport properties between photons and phonons, and we will introduce ballistic and wave transport properties as well as heat transport phenomena and control techniques by their hybrid modes.
